About Deryll

Deryll, a variant of the classic name Darrel, exudes a sense of openness and connection to nature. With its origins in Old English and Old French, the name carries a charming historical significance. The meaning of Deryll, "open", embodies a welcoming and receptive spirit. Additionally, Deryll is associated with "Airelle", a French term for blueberry, evoking images of sweet summer berries and the freshness of the outdoors.
